The AirTAC AirTAC SDA50X150SBH Compact Cylinder | 50mm Bore is a genuine double-acting COMPACT (thin) air cylinder with a Ø50mm bore and 150mm stroke, PT1/4 air ports and a riveted short body that saves mounting depth. Sensor slots around the body accept magnetic switches for position sensing.
The AirTAC SDA50X150SBH is a double-acting, single-rod compact cylinder engineered for tight axial footprints. Its riveted assembly keeps overall length minimal where conventional round bodies cannot fit. Delivering 981.7 N of push force at 0.5 MPa, this unit steps up to a 20 mm piston rod and PT1/4 ports. The -H code specifies fluororubber (FKM) seals for enhanced thermal and oil resistance.
This configuration includes a built-in piston magnet (-S) for direct mounting of AirTAC reed or electronic switches along the body grooves. The -B option provides a male M18x1.5 threaded rod end for secure mechanical coupling. Because the 150 mm stroke exceeds the 130 mm standard maximum for this bore, it is produced as a made-to-order item. End-stops rely on a fixed NBR bumper rather than an adjustable air cushion.

When sizing this actuator, evaluate your force margins carefully. Stepping down to the SDA40 yields 628.3 N of push at 0.5 MPa, while moving up to the SDA63 provides 1558.6 N. At 981.7 N push, this 50 mm bore handles a safe working load of roughly 589 N (about 60 percent capacity) or a 50 kg vertical lift with a 2:1 safety factor. If your mechanism must maintain position during air loss or valve centering, add an external rod lock or pilot-operated check valve, as the piston will drift.
To order correctly, confirm the 50 mm bore, 150 mm non-standard stroke, PT1/4 porting, FKM seals, the male M18x1.5 rod thread, and the integrated switch magnet. Operating speed spans 30-500 mm/s. For high kinetic energy at stroke ends, install external shock absorbers since the standard NBR bumper only decelerates the impact and cannot act as a brake.
